Creating the Base
When it comes to making your own sandals, the first step is to create the base. The base of the sandals is what provides the foundation for the rest of the design and ensures comfort and durability.
Start by selecting a high-quality leather that is suitable for footwear crafting. Leather is a popular choice for sandals as it is durable and molds to the shape of your feet over time, providing a comfortable fit.
Next, measure your feet to determine the size of the base. Trace the outline of your feet onto the leather using a marker or pen. Make sure to include some extra space around the edges to allow for stitching and adjustments.
Once you have the outline, carefully cut out the leather using sharp scissors or a craft knife. Take your time to ensure clean and precise cuts. You will need two pieces of leather for each sandal, one for the top and one for the bottom.
After cutting out the leather pieces, it’s time to assemble the base. Place the bottom piece on a flat surface and align the top piece on top of it. Make sure they are centered and match up perfectly. Pin the two pieces together to hold them in place.
Now, it’s time to stitch the two pieces together. Using a strong thread and a leather needle, sew along the edges of the base, making sure to secure the pieces together tightly. You can use a simple running stitch or a more decorative stitch pattern, depending on your preference.
Once you have finished stitching, remove the pins and try on the base to check the fit. Make any necessary adjustments to ensure the sandals are comfortable and snug.

Measure Your Feet
Before you start making your own leather sandals, you need to measure your feet to ensure the perfect fit. Here’s how:
- Find a flat surface and place a piece of paper on it.
- Stand on the paper with your heel against a wall.
- Using a pencil, trace the outline of your foot.
- Measure the length from the heel to the longest toe.
- Measure the width at the widest part of your foot.
- Repeat the process for the other foot.
By accurately measuring your feet, you can create custom-made sandals that fit perfectly and provide maximum comfort. Remember to take these measurements into account when crafting your own footwear.

Can I use old flip flops to make sandals?
Yes, you can use old flip flops as a base to make sandals. Simply remove the existing straps and replace them with fabric or leather straps of your choice. This way, you can give your old flip flops a new and stylish look.
